and (JF) stock outlook | technical indicators and broader market trends remain in focus. J and Friends Holdings Limited ADRs (JF) declined by 1.49% to close at $0.99. The stock is currently trading near its established support level of $0.94, while facing overhead resistance at $1.04. The move extended recent weakness and places the shares in a key technical zone.

The price action over the past several sessions shows a series of lower peaks, forming a potential descending triangle pattern. If the $0.94 support is broken on above-average volume, the next downside target may lie in the $0.85–$0.90 area. On the upside, a break above $1.04 would negate the short-term bearish outlook and open the door to the $1.10–$1.15 range. Technical indicators are likely in oversold territory, with the Relative Strength Index potentially hovering in the mid-30s, suggesting that selling pressure may be exhausted in the near term. Moving averages, such as the 50-day SMA, likely remain above the current price, reinforcing the bearish trend. The stock is also trading below the 200-day moving average, indicating a longer-term downtrend. However, oversold conditions do not guarantee a reversal, and the stock may consolidate before any meaningful move. Traders should watch for a close above $1.00 to gain short-term momentum. Looking ahead, JF’s next move depends on whether it can defend the $0.94 support level. A bounce from this area could lead to a test of the $1.04 resistance, which has capped gains in recent weeks. Conversely, a decisive breakdown below $0.94 might accelerate selling pressure, potentially driving the stock toward the $0.85–$0.90 zone. Several factors could influence future performance, including any company-specific announcements, changes in market sentiment toward small-cap ADRs, or broader economic data. The stock’s low liquidity may amplify price swings, making it more sensitive to order flow. Positive news such as earnings updates, strategic partnerships, or regulatory approvals could shift sentiment and attract buyers. On the other hand, negative headlines or a risk-off environment could push the stock lower. Given the current technical setup, the stock may remain range-bound between $0.94 and $1.04 until a catalyst emerges. Traders should monitor volume for confirmation of any breakout or breakdown. A sustained move above $1.04 on increasing volume would signal renewed buying interest, while a drop below $0.94 on heavy volume would indicate further downside risk.
